An upgraded scanner built by Professor Cyprus that detects Pokémon signatures, hidden abilities, egg moves, and weather-sensitive spawn data.
Sneak toward shaking grass, confirm the silhouette, then chain captures. Each successful encounter boosts IV rolls, move inheritance, and shiny rate.
Chain milestones (5/10/25) reward passive buffs like +1 egg move slot, +10% shiny odds, or double loot from Hidden Grottos.

Certain bushes glow cyan, indicating a guaranteed hidden ability if you keep stealth walking. Combine with the Scanner Lens item for alerts.
DexNav chains add +0.05% per encounter up to +3% when combined with the Luminous Charm. Fleeing or catching a different species resets the bonus.
Running, biking, fainting your lead, or entering menus longer than 20 seconds breaks the chain. Use Repels and toggle 'Auto-Run Off' to maintain stealth.
Farm Storm Puff on Route 2 during thunderstorms, combine Luminous Charm, and stick to 50+ chains for sub-hour shinies.
Use the Ferrystone ferry to hop between microclimates—Route 9 at dusk spawns DexNav-only Spiritomb, while Crystal Rift nights spawn Sound-type Eeveelutions.
Consult the Harbor Observatory board to see hourly weather seeds. Schedule DexNav hunts for sandstorms or auroras to expand spawn pools.
